How a Reload Offer Actually Works

A reload bonus is essentially a second-chance deposit match, thrown into the mix after your first sign-up package has been claimed. You put money in, the operator matches a slice of it, and the extra credit sits there ready to spin the reels. The trick is in the fine print - wagering requirements, game weightings, and time limits all shape whether the offer is worth a crack. Most Aussie punters know the drill by now, but the details still catch people out when they're scanning the promotions page in a hurry.

The structure varies from one operator to the next, with some matching a flat percentage and others tiering the reward based on how much you deposit. A modest top-up might snag you a thirty per cent match, while a bigger commitment can unlock a higher rate with a few extra perks thrown in. The common thread is simple: the operator wants you to keep the balance healthy, and you want the terms to feel fair enough to justify the spin.

Reading the Fine Print Without the Headache

Wagering requirements are the first thing worth a proper look, because a thirtyfold playthrough on a modest match can eat into your enjoyment faster than a hot summer afternoon. The multiplier tells you how many times you need to stake the bonus before any winnings become withdrawable, and it's worth checking whether the count includes your own deposit or just the bonus credit. Some operators run the requirement on the combined total, which is tougher, while others keep it to the bonus alone, which is a bit more forgiving.

Time limits are the other sneaky detail, because a generous offer can turn into a rush if you've only got a handful of days to clear the playthrough. A week or two is fairly standard, but anything shorter than that starts to feel like a sprint rather than a session. Picking the Right Pokies for the Bonus

Not every slot is built the same, and the reels you choose can make a reload offer feel generous or grating depending on how they contribute to the wagering. High-volatility pokies can stretch a balance with long dry spells, while low-variance titles tend to pay smaller wins more often and keep the action moving. If you're working through a wagering requirement, a steadier game can help you tick over the playthrough without burning through the bonus in a handful of spins.

Some operators let you filter by contribution rate, which is a handy feature if you want to keep the progress moving without wasting time on games that count for next to nothing.
